Lake Wales extended their postseason success on Friday against Sebring. They walked away with a 3-1 win over the Sebring Blue Streaks. Winning may never get old, but the Highlanders sure are getting used to it with their fourth in a row.
Vallery Rodriguez went supernova for Lake Wales, getting 39 digs and three aces. Rodriguez is on a roll when it comes to digs, as she's now had 17 or more in the last four games she's played dating back to last season.
Lake Wales' victory was their tenth stra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 19-2. As for Sebring, with the defeat, they broke their six-game winning streak and moved their record to 18-6.
